MBRP vs SLP vs JAWS Cans???

L

lovethedeep

New member
how loud are the slp vs the mbrp and jaws? I want nice sound but not so terrible loud. also, best weight??
thanks
 
Have had both slp and Mbrp on past M Cat sleds. The slp was quality built and close to stock sound levels with a very "tinny" sound. The Mbrp had a good aggressive sound but a little too loud for me. With an open intake and the Mbrp can, It was almost obnoxious. Sorry i don't have any comparisons on the axys but hope this helps.
 
I have the jaws trail can on my axys, the slp is close to stock noise.. jaws has a deeper sound then the mbrp on my buddies pro.
 
I have not experience with Jaws. I have the MBRP trail can and it's not bad, really screams once the power valves open but not as loud as the GGb mountain can but louder then the SLP.
 
SLP is probably the quietest,after a weekend of riding it I wouldn't go back to the loud cans that I have had in the past. My Pro had the MBRP trail can, it was pretty mellow and sounded good. Jaws is loud.
 
My Jaws Race allowed me to add some primary weight, it gained some RPM with the can.
 
GGB trail can is louder then jaws trail... and so is the ggb race can louder then jaws race can.
 
With the Canadian dollar being so weak, if I were a USA guy, I would seriously consider buying a MBRP. With exchange they should be under $225 US and the fit and finish is excellent. 6 lbs for the trail version which is only slightly louder than stock and made out od nice shiny stainless steel and great fit..
 
Mbrp can lost rpm on my buddies axys like 200 rpm. Put stock back on and gain the 200 rpm back.. jaws and slp can never made a difference in rpm..
 
I really like my SLP. Makes a great mounting spot for my Muff Pot. It is "tinny" sounding like others have said. In the pow it sounds about stock unless you carve and get the right side up, then it is a bit louder but not obnoxious at all.

GGB Exhaust has two sounds to choose from. We have a Mountain Can and a Trail Can.

Mountain Can:

This muffler is a super lightweight, straight through flow design with an aggressive exhaust note. System fits securely in the stock location using stock mounts and is guaranteed to provide performance levels as good as or better than stock. GGB Mountain mufflers are designed to be used in areas where increased sound levels are not an issue. These cans are loud when you open the throttle. Please use accordingly.


Trail Can:
Lightweight muffler with a trail tuned muscle sound. Neighbor friendly and in most applications will meet SAE J2567 stationary test of 88 db, 4 meters away. System fits securely in the original location using stock mounts and is guaranteed to provide performance levels as good as or better than stock. GGB Trail mufflers are specifically designed for use in populated areas and where sound levels are strictly enforced.

Weight:
Mountain Can will be 4-5 LBS
Trail Can will be 6-7 LBS
